What is DPI and Why Does It Matter?

DPI stands for dots per inch, and it’s a measure of the screen’s pixel density. Higher DPI means more pixels per inch, resulting in sharper images and text. Conversely, lower DPI can make on-screen elements appear larger and more readable. Adjusting DPI settings allows you to tailor the display to your preferences, whether you want everything to be more compact or easier to see.

Step-by-Step Guide to a Total Different Way of Adjusting DPI

  1. Access Developer Options: First, enable developer options by going to Settings > About Phone and tapping the Build Number seven times. This unlocks additional settings that are crucial for DPI adjustments.
  2. Use ADB Commands: Instead of relying on device settings alone, use ADB (Android Debug Bridge) commands for more precise control. Connect your device to a computer and open a command prompt or terminal window. Enter the following command to check your current DPI:
    adb shell wm density

    To change the DPI, use:

    css
    adb shell wm density [desired DPI]

    Replace [desired DPI] with the value you want. For instance, setting it to 420 can make the interface more compact.

  3. Third-Party Apps: For those who prefer not to use ADB commands, third-party apps like “DPI Changer” can offer a user-friendly interface for making adjustments. However, ensure that these apps are reputable and have good reviews to avoid any potential issues.
  4. Reboot Your Device: After making changes, always reboot your device to ensure the new settings take effect.

Troubleshooting and Tips

  • Backup Your Settings: Before making any changes, it’s wise to note down your current DPI settings or create a backup. This allows you to revert if needed.
  • Gradual Changes: Adjust DPI settings gradually to avoid drastic changes that might make your device difficult to use.
